The key to a stress-free and enjoyable May Day vacation lies in careful planning and smart choices. Whether you’re looking for a relaxing getaway or an adventurous trip, the right preparation can make all the difference. This guide will walk you through the essential steps to plan your ideal May Day trip, from setting your budget to choosing the perfect destination.

When planning a May Day vacation, the first step is to determine your travel goals. Are you seeking relaxation, adventure, or cultural experiences? Your answer will shape the rest of your planning process. For instance, if you’re aiming for a peaceful retreat, a beach destination or a mountain resort might be ideal. On the other hand, if you’re looking for excitement, cities with rich history or vibrant nightlife could be the perfect fit.

Next, consider your budget. May Day is a popular travel period, so prices for flights, accommodation, and activities can be higher than usual. It’s wise to book in advance and compare options to secure the best deals. Set a realistic budget that includes transportation, lodging, meals, and entertainment. This will help you avoid overspending and ensure a smoother trip.

Choosing the right destination is another crucial step. Think about what you want to experience during your trip. If you prefer a quiet escape, consider a secluded beach or a countryside retreat. If you’re a foodie, explore a city known for its culinary scene. For those who love nature, a national park or a hiking trail could be the perfect choice. Research the weather, local attractions, and any special events happening during the May Day holiday to make the most of your trip.

Once you’ve chosen your destination, it’s time to plan your itinerary. Break down your days into manageable segments, ensuring you have a balance of activities and downtime. Include must-see attractions, local restaurants, and relaxation spots. Don’t forget to factor in travel time between locations, especially if you’re visiting multiple places. A well-structured itinerary will help you make the most of your time and avoid last-minute stress.

Packing is another important aspect of trip planning. Depending on your destination and activities, your packing list may vary. For a beach vacation, bring swimwear, sunscreen, and a towel. If you’re visiting a city, comfortable shoes and a light jacket might be necessary. Don’t forget to pack essential documents like your passport, travel insurance, and any required visas. A checklist can help you avoid forgetting important items.

To illustrate how these steps can work in practice, let’s take the example of a family planning a May Day trip to Hangzhou. First, they decide on a relaxing vacation, aiming to enjoy the city’s natural beauty and cultural landmarks. They set a budget that includes flights, accommodation, and activities, booking in advance to secure the best prices. They choose Hangzhou for its famous West Lake and tea culture. Their itinerary includes a visit to the West Lake, a tea tasting session, and a day trip to the Longjing Tea Plantation. They pack light, bringing comfortable walking shoes, a reusable water bottle, and a camera to capture the moments. This thoughtful planning ensures a smooth and enjoyable trip for the whole family.

In addition to planning, staying flexible is key. While it’s important to have a rough itinerary, unexpected changes can happen, such as weather delays or last-minute opportunities. Being adaptable can turn potential setbacks into memorable experiences. For example, if a planned activity is canceled, use the time to explore a nearby attraction or enjoy a spontaneous meal at a local restaurant.

Lastly, safety and health should always be a priority. Check for any travel advisories or health guidelines, especially if you’re visiting a new country. Pack necessary medications, and ensure you have travel insurance that covers medical emergencies. Staying informed and prepared will help you enjoy your trip without unnecessary worries.

By following these steps and keeping your goals in mind, you can create a May Day vacation that is both enjoyable and stress-free. Whether you’re traveling alone, with family, or with friends, a well-planned trip can make all the difference in creating lasting memories.
